Simple Things You Can Do To Be A Better Photographer

Whether you are an aspiring photographer or a snap-happy proud parent, this handpicked selection of the best and brightest photography tips, is sure to get you well on your way to becoming the next Ansel Adams. Learn how to create beautiful, composed shots and infuse each photo with creativity and beauty.

The right lighting is very important when establishing a certain tone or mood. Be clear about the type of lighting you want in your photographs and don't just settle for whatever lighting is available.

When you have the perfect shot in view and you are ready to push the shutter, make sure that you hold your breath and do not move an inch. Any slight movement can ruin a shot. Take a spare second, right before hitting the shutter button, to hold your breath and get a straight shot.

When you are taking landscape photos, consider the sky. If the sky is rather bland and boring, do not let it dominate the photo. If the sky is lit up with wonderful colors (especially during sunrise, sunset or a storm) it is okay to let the sky dominate the photo.

Do your best to make your models feel at ease, especially if you do not know them. A lot of people look at someone taking pictures as a potential threat. Be friendly, strike up a conversation and ask permission to take pictures. Make people understand photography is an art rather than an invasion of their privacy.

Take lots of shots. Using a digital camera allows you to take essentially an infinite number of photos for free. The more shots you take, the better your chances are of capturing that perfect moment. If your shot didn't come out like you wanted, try again with different settings. You won't learn if you don't try.

Stand close to what you are trying to take a picture of. This way, the object will cover the entire screen. This works really well when taking a picture of a flower or other non-living object. If you can not get close enough, use the zoom button on your camera.

As with all things in life, your photography skills can not improve if you do not get out there and practice! Digital photography has opened up a whole new world to those who may have been previously afraid to put their skills to the test. Without the fear of wasting film and development costs, you can feel free to snap away and learn from the good and the bad.

Make use of panning for some great and interesting shots. This means following the image with your camera. When applied correctly to your shooting conditions, you will end up with sharp details on your subject matter. You will also end up with a motion blur on everything else, making for a great shot.

Every picture you take needs a focal point. Determine your focal point before you snap the picture. When trying to determine the focal point, try to think about what will draw the viewer in. Keep the focal point simple, if you use too many focal points it will only confuse the view. You do not have to make your focal point be the center of the picture, but it does need to stand out.

When you are trying to capture that perfect panoramic shot, it is important that you use a tripod. The tripod will help you take a few steady shots of the view you want to capture. Later on this will make it easier for you to piece it all together to get that panoramic view.

When it's time to print your photographs from a digital camera, always choose papers made specifically for photographic images. Plain papers are uncoated and diffuse the ink, while inkjet photo papers have a sturdy base and are coated with ink-absorbing surfaces. Try a matte paper for an elegant, artistic finish.
